Before the signing session begins, confirm the color-contrast accessibility audit for the Brightloom ceremony console has passed. New team members: this matters because operators read key fingerprints off the screen under dim vault lighting, and failed contrast ratios have caused transcription errors in past ceremonies at the Kettlebrook site. Verify the audit report is attached to the ceremony record and countersigned by the accessibility lead, Mara Tilsen. Once verified, record the recovery passphrase shown below in the sealed logbook.

unlock words, yawig-kagef: gordor-holvan-ulaael-pramir-ulaiel-tamdor

Subject: DR drill — ReportWeave sort-stability module

Team,

Next Thursday we run the disaster-recovery drill for ReportWeave's report builder, focusing on the sort-stability service that guarantees deterministic ordering across rebuilds. As the assigned security reviewer, you'll restore the module from cold backup on the isolated Fenmoor cluster. The restore wizard will prompt for the drill recovery passphrase, which I'm including directly below for your records.

vault phrase of bagaf-kajeg = jorath-feniel-briir-siliel-ralix

Welcome to the Quillstream team! Our message queue keeps topics lean via log compaction — older records with the same key get swept away, leaving only the latest value. Compaction runs nightly on the Delver cluster, so don't panic if old offsets vanish. If compaction ever wedges and you need the admin recovery console, unlock it with the passphrase below.

vault phrase of taweg-kafof = oliax-zorael

Handover for the weekly eng sync: I'm transferring ownership of Duskrunner, our nightly backfill scheduler, to Priya. Current state: all jobs healthy except the ledger-reconciliation backfill, which retries once nightly due to a slow upstream from the Kestwick warehouse. Retry logic, window sizing, and concurrency caps were all tuned carefully last quarter — please don't change them without a load test. For full transparency at the sync, the production instance runs with these configuration values.

settings of hawep-kadug:
RALAEL_HOST=ralael.tolvaqlabs.internal
RALAEL_PORT=9000